Islands of Bermuda are located right on the edge of The North Atlantic Gyre which obviously is a major contributing factor to the amount of trash found on its beaches. What is interesting is that many Bermudians are not aware of this problem at all. Most people will tell you that the reason their beaches are so clean is because they have many organizations on the island that do beach clean ups. It is true, many organizations such as Greenrock.org and Keep Bermuda Beautiful doing a lot of work to keep Bermuda as clean as possible. I don't even want to imagine how it would all look without these companies doing their work. But what people don't know is that some things just cannot be cleaned up.
